Akagi雀魂智能辅助工具:提升麻将决策效率的AI助手
Akagi雀魂智能辅助工具(以下简称Akagi)是一款基于深度学习技术的麻将辅助应用,通过实时牌局分析和AI决策支持,帮助玩家提升游戏策略与决策效率。该工具集成百万牌局训练的AI决策系统,提供从新手到进阶的全阶段辅助,无需复杂配置即可快速上手,不影响游戏原生体验。
一、价值解析:重新定义麻将辅助体验
传统麻将辅助工具的痛点
传统麻将辅助工具普遍存在三大局限:策略建议同质化严重,无法适应不同水平玩家需求;数据分析滞后,无法实时响应牌局变化;系统资源占用高,影响游戏流畅度。这些问题导致多数辅助工具沦为简单的牌型分析器,难以真正提升玩家水平。
Akagi的差异化解决方案
Akagi通过三大创新技术突破传统局限:动态决策模型根据玩家历史行为调整建议风格;实时数据处理引擎确保0.3秒内完成局势评估;轻量化架构设计使内存占用控制在200MB以内,实现性能与效率的完美平衡。
核心收获:AI驱动的动态辅助系统,实现个性化麻将策略支持。
二、环境部署:5分钟完成初始设置
系统环境适配指南
Akagi支持Windows 10/11及macOS 12+系统,最低配置要求4GB内存和10GB可用存储空间。安装前需确保系统已安装Python 3.8+环境和Git版本控制工具。
快速部署流程
🔍 Windows系统部署:
- 打开管理员权限PowerShell
- 执行部署命令:
git clone https://gitcode.com/gh_mirrors/ak/Akagi
cd Akagi
scripts\install_akagi.ps1
⚠️ 注意:若出现"执行策略"错误,需先运行Set-ExecutionPolicy RemoteSigned并选择"Y"确认
✅ macOS系统部署:
- 打开终端应用
- 执行一键部署命令:
git clone https://gitcode.com/gh_mirrors/ak/Akagi && cd Akagi && bash scripts/install_akagi.command
关键配置三步骤
- 证书信任配置:安装过程中会弹出系统证书安装提示,需在钥匙串访问中设置"始终信任"
- AI模型部署:将下载的mortal.pth模型文件放置于mjai/bot目录
- 网络代理设置:根据安装向导完成代理配置,确保游戏流量正确路由
小贴士:模型文件大小约800MB,建议使用高速网络下载以节省部署时间
核心收获:跨平台一键部署,三步完成安全配置。
三、功能矩阵:全方位辅助系统解析
实时决策支持系统
Akagi的核心功能模块通过三层架构实现精准辅助:
- 数据采集层:通过进程内Hook技术捕获手牌、舍牌记录、剩余牌池等实时数据
- 分析引擎层:基于深度学习模型计算各种打法的胜率概率分布
- 交互反馈层:通过桌面悬浮窗提供直观的出牌建议和局势分析
个性化配置中心
通过修改项目根目录的config.json文件,玩家可自定义三大类参数:
- 决策风格:从"保守型"(高胜率优先)到"激进型"(高得分优先)五档调节
- 界面显示:建议提示方式(文字/图标/音效)和信息密度控制
- 账号管理:多账号快速切换和自动登录设置
高级功能探索
- 牌谱分析工具:自动记录并分析历史对局,生成个人技术统计报告
- 对手行为建模:通过机器学习识别对手打牌风格,提供针对性策略
- 多开支持:同时辅助多个游戏实例,适合直播或多账号管理场景
核心收获:三层架构实现精准辅助,支持深度个性化配置。
四、成长路径:从新手到高手的进阶指南
安全使用框架
为确保账号安全,建议遵循以下使用准则:
- 游戏行为自然化:避免连续接受AI建议,保持30%以上的自主决策
- 使用环境隔离:优先在独立设备或虚拟机中运行辅助工具
- 版本更新及时:每周执行
git pull获取最新安全补丁
常见问题故障树
启动故障
├─证书错误 → 重新运行安装脚本并信任证书
├─模型加载失败 → 检查mjai/bot/mortal.pth文件完整性
└─依赖缺失 → 执行pip install -r requirement.txt重新安装依赖
网络问题 ├─连接超时 → 检查代理服务器状态 ├─数据同步失败 → 验证防火墙设置 └─游戏版本不匹配 → 更新至最新版雀魂客户端
技能提升方法论
Akagi的最佳使用方式是将其作为学习工具:
- 对比分析:每局后比较自己的决策与AI建议的差异
- 模式识别:关注AI在特定牌型下的策略倾向
- 渐进脱离:随着水平提升逐步降低AI建议强度
核心收获:安全使用框架+故障排查指南+技能提升路径。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0191
cann-learning-hubCANN 学习中心仓,支持在线互动运行、边学边练,提供教程、示例与优化方案,一站式助力昇腾开发者快速上手。Jupyter Notebook0114
Step-3.7-FlashStep-3.7-Flash是一个拥有 1980 亿参数的稀疏混合专家(MoE)视觉语言模型,由 1960 亿参数的语言主干网络和 18 亿参数的视觉编码器组合而成,具备原生图像理解能力。Python00
JoyAI-EchoJoyAI-Echo,这是一个独立的、仅用于推理的版本,旨在实现分钟级多镜头音视频生成。它采用了经过蒸馏的DMD生成器、配对的跨模态记忆以及故事级别的一致性。其性能的核心在于,一个跨模态视听记忆库能够在长达五分钟的视频中保持角色外观和语音音色的一致性。同时,一个训练后处理流程将基于记忆的强化学习与分布匹配蒸馏相结合,实现了7.5倍的速度提升,显著增强了视觉质量和对齐效果。00
omega-aiOmega-AI:基于java打造的深度学习框架,帮助你快速搭建神经网络,实现模型推理与训练,引擎支持自动求导,多线程与GPU运算,GPU支持CUDA,CUDNN。Java04
llm-universe本项目是一个面向小白开发者的大模型应用开发教程,在线阅读地址:https://datawhalechina.github.io/llm-universe/Jupyter Notebook08